首先我们建立 HTML 的基本结构,定义 HTML 文档的类型、语言、头部信息以及页面内容。<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Todo List</title> <style media="screen"> /* CSS 样式 */ </style> <script> /* JavaScript 脚本 */ </scri...
首先我们建立 HTML 的基本结构,定义 HTML 文档的类型、语言、头部信息以及页面内容。 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Todo List</title> <style media="screen"> /* CSS 样式 */ </style> <script> /* JavaScript 脚本 */ </script> </head> <body> ...
首先我们建立 HTML 的基本结构,定义 HTML 文档的类型、语言、头部信息以及页面内容。 代码语言:javascript 复制 <!DOCTYPEhtml><html lang="en"><head><meta charset="UTF-8"><title>Todo List</title><style media="screen">/* CSS 样式 */</style><script>/* JavaScript 脚本 */</script></head><bod...
首先我们建立 HTML 的基本结构,定义 HTML 文档的类型、语言、头部信息以及页面内容。 <!DOCTYPE html><htmllang="en"><head><metacharset="UTF-8"><title>Todo List</title><stylemedia="screen">/* CSS 样式 */</style><script>/* JavaScript 脚本 */</script></head><body><!-- HTML 页面内容 --...
原生js实现todolist 这是官方web版的todolist的一个小小页面 http://www.todolist.cn/ 其实会一些简单的js语法跟一些基本的DOM操作完全可以实现。 我这个无法保存数据,至少单纯实现效果。 这里是简单的css样式。 * { margin: 0; padding: 0; } ul{
ToDoList.js $(function() {// 页面每次加载,就自动渲染一次数据load(); $("#title").on("keydown",function(event) {// 判断用户按下了回车键(13)if(event.keyCode==13) {if($(this).val() =="") {alert("请输入待办事项!"); }else{// 先读取本地存取原来的数据varlocal =getData();// ...
首先我们建立 HTML 的基本结构,定义 HTML 文档的类型、语言、头部信息以及页面内容。 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Todo List</title> <style media="screen"> /* CSS 样式 */ </style> <script> ...
首先我们建立 HTML 的基本结构,定义 HTML 文档的类型、语言、头部信息以及页面内容。 <!DOCTYPE html><html lang="en"><head><meta charset="UTF-8"><title>Todo List</title><style media="screen">/* CSS 样式 */</style><script>/* JavaScript 脚本 */</script></head><body><!-- HTML 页面内容...
在src目录下新建assets文件加用来防止css文件和图片文件等静态资源; 如图2.5所示: 图2.5 三、实现过程 3.1 创建组件ToDoList 在components文件夹下新建ToDoList.jsx文件,编写如下代码,搭好一个组件的基本框架;代码如下: 代码语言:javascript 代码运行次数:0
const taskList = document.querySelector('.task_list') renderTask() info.addEventListener('submit', function (e) { e.preventDefault() //去除前后空格 let taskValue = task.value.trim() if (taskValue) { error_message.textContent = ''